  6. Sometime last year I bought a 10" bresser dob with help from this forum. I had some good times in my back garden with a perfect south view despite being town centre. Unfortunately over the winter there was a large and permanent increase in light pollution. So much so it was never actually dark and I gave up using the scope. I have since moved as planned to what the internet tells me is bortle 4. The view from my back garden is primarily N/NE which I can see down to 5degree above the horizon without obstruction in almost complete darkness. If I shuffle around I can also get about 15degrees south albeit with light pollution domes. If I can work out how to transport my dob on foot I can also go to a completely open area in every direction about 500m from my front door. Overhead I can see some detail of the Milky Way. So all in all a new world right on my doorstep. I was out of the hobby so long I forgot I had bought an astronomic UHC filter which I found in my kit unopened. The first two nights since moving I have spent working out how to use everything again. I have now got naked eye objects like the double cluster. The fact I can actually see stuff just by looking is making finding objects a lot easier. M31 was always a struggle now I can find it instantly. Through the EP the main difference is M110 is easily seen too. I like nebula so I tend to focus on that using a zoom EP. M27 is a grey blob on the finder scope. Through the EP I tried sticking an Oii and UHC on and comparing. I couldn't really see any difference. Both ways I can see the 'apple core' and the fainter 'bubble' around it. M57 however was different. The UHC filter gave a bright outer right and a black middle. Oiii gave me the ring but also inside I could see very faint the central star. I also managed to fit in a look at Jupiter and four of it's moons. There is a lot of haze in the direction so the seeing was poor but I could make out the banding and define the different colours, in moments of clarity. Add to all that all I can really hear is some strange bird or animal calling now and again. Being able to sit out and observe is certainly good for mental health and appreciating whats around.

  11. I got out last night. Looking back at my logs the last clear night I was able to get out was 22nd Nov 2020! Got sight of: Eskimo nebula: no filter this time. Averted vision could see the nebula as green and direct vision the star within only. With oiii filter last time it was blue. Hubble variable nebula: also no filter and appears white/grey. Christmas tree cluster Crab Nebula: almost missed it. It was probably about as faint an object as my eye will detect. However it is pretty big. Absolutely no detail just an elongated oval of smudge. Looking in to buying a UHC filter which might help? Rosette Nebula: Couldn't see the nebula but saw the saw cluster. Again a UHC filter may help apparently? M36/M37/M38 Lambda Orionis system: Don't usually bother checking out double stars but since the sky was so bright I tried it. Probably try a few more. Very little separation which made it worthwhile when I could make it out.

  19. Speaking as another newbie this is the key bit. It took me a few sessions to be able to have some certainty that I had seen my target. In order to assist I found you need planning and prep with research. Set out a list of a couple of objects to find. Plan how to find them. Research written/sketch/photographic sources of what the object looks like. Find it and take a good look, then come back and have another read about the object. The problem is until you look through a telescope you haven't looked through a telescope. Photographs are a different kettle of fish. Looking at sketches is more helpful. Read observing reports and how people described something and what EPs they used. If you look at my post history it might give ideas of simple plans to look at a few objects, from the POV of a newbie. If you want more doubles have a look at Andromeda quite a few kicking around.

  25. Forecasted for clear sky from 1300hrs until tomorrow morning, I decided to try a session getting outdoors early and seeing what difference it made to things. Working from a 10" dob with a Hyperion zoom and 2.25x Barlow I started with our own solar system and then went for M31. 1530hrs~ Moon - With a twilight blue background it was a lot easier to view the moon. It's apparent brightness was significantly reduced so it was easy on the eye. I particularly enjoyed what appeared to be mountain ridges and the crater of theophilus and the other two in the chain next to it. It was nice to go up to 350x magnification and back out to study the little mountain in the crater. Sea of serenity I could see the Bessel crater and bright streaks of lighter grey cutting across it. 1600hrs ~ As soon as Jupiter popped up I switched my sights. Last time I looked I could see the great red spot. Tonight it wasn't there so instead I was looking at beige and brown banding. All four of the main moons very brightly visible. There was a fair bit of shimmering in the atmosphere. There was no point going above 250x and somewhere between 180-250x was the sweet spot. 1620hrs~ Saturn now visible. Saturn being my favourite I have had a look every night I have had. Tonight however was a different story. This was the most outstanding view I have had in the past few weeks. The sweet spot was 180x-200x with some turbulence however there was brief moments of amazing clarity. For the time I saw the Cassini division. The rings were an off white and the body was a pale yellow with some darker contrasting yellow in it. Gradually the moons came in to view which was also a first. Titan was the most obvious, followed by Dione and Rhea all over a period of 20-30 minutes. 1700hrs Jupiter and Saturn were moving too low behind the houses so I went for Mars. I looked a few weeks ago and have amazing clarity seeing the southern ice cap and various surface markings. Tonight and yesterday it was terrible. Very poor seeing in this direction and no matter how much I tried I couldn't get a view worth bothering with. At some point I then noticed Andromeda constellation was significantly lower and a bit easier to look at than when I usually get outside. Normally I am struggling trying to point the scope straight up but tonight it was a lot lower. I spent 30-40 minutes trying to find M31 first from memory, then from a chart, then pulling out the binoculars. By this point I found I had been tracking from the wrong star. Luckily however that meant I could see Almach in my scope purely by mistake. Very nice contrast of blue and gold. M31 - having found with the binoculars I then found it at 53x. A large bright core with a fuzz around it which I was very happy to see. As a bonus M32 was hiding in plain sight. Basically M31 but on a smaller scale. It is great to see two galaxies for the price of one. About 2,5hrs later I realised my body temperature had plummeted and called it a day whilst I could still walk.
